    Confirm your waiver deadline first

    If you plan to use a DIANins plan instead of UCLA school insurance, please submit your Fall 2026 waiver by September 20, 2026.

    UCLA does not list a Fall 2026 late waiver fee on its official waiver calendar. If you do not receive an approved waiver by the deadline, you will remain enrolled in UCSHIP and be financially responsible for the UCSHIP Health Registration Fee on BruinBill.

    UCLA's school insurance plan is UC Student Health Insurance Plan (UCSHIP).

    If your waiver is approved before tuition is paid, UCLA will remove the UCSHIP charge from your semester bill.

    If tuition has already been paid, UCLA will credit the UCSHIP charge back to your BruinBill student account after waiver approval.

    INSURANCE TERMS

    Common insurance terms

    Understanding these terms can help you compare benefits and estimate medical costs more accurately.

    Deductible

    The amount you pay before your insurance begins sharing covered medical costs.

    Copay

    A fixed amount you pay for certain medical services, such as doctor visits or prescriptions.

    Coinsurance

    The percentage of covered costs you pay after meeting your deductible.

    Out-of-pocket maximum

    The maximum amount you pay for covered in-network services during a policy period.

    In-network

    Doctors, hospitals, pharmacies, or clinics contracted with the insurance network.

    Premium

    The amount you pay to purchase and maintain active insurance coverage.
